This book, in parts, reads like a selection of recipes, and this is intentional. Several excellent publications exist to describe the quantum size effects, the physics, physical chemistry and mathematics involved in quantum dots, but few directly tackle what inorganic and materials chemists might want: a tool kit to describe how to make quantum dots, precursors, conditions, and what properties (usually optical) might result. t
